Abstract

The invention discloses a method for remedying organic contaminated soil through electric diffusion-electric heating coupling. According to the method, a direct-current electric field is applied to achieve directed migration of persulfate molecules in the contaminated soil; and after persulfate migrates to a target contaminated area, an alternating-current electric field is adopted, and heat generated by currents is used for in-situ activation of the persulfate, so that sulfate radical anions with the strong oxidizing property are generated to degrade pollutants. By adoption of the method, directed and rapid migration of an oxidizing agent, namely the persulfate, in soil can be achieved, and meanwhile, controllable efficient in-situ activation of the persulfate in soil can also be achieved.

Technical field:

[0001] The invention belongs to the technical field of environmental protection, relates to the restoration of soil organic pollution, and in particular relates to a method for repairing soil organic pollution coupled with electrodynamic diffusion and electric heating. Background technique:

[0002] Soil pollution caused by industrial emissions, mining, transportation, etc. has become an important factor restricting the sustainable development of my country's economy and society. Treatment methods for contaminated soil include landfill, incineration, high-temperature desorption, soil leaching, chemical oxidation, and microbial remediation, among which the in-situ chemical oxidation (ISCO) technology has become a Main methods of groundwater and soil remediation.
